The Number of Man:
Climax of Civilization
by
Philip Mauro
(2nd edition, 1919)
Philip Mauro was a prolific author in the first half of the 1900s, writing over 40 books before his death. He was well-known as a U.S. Supreme Court lawyer.
About this book:
The writer saw the things going on around him both politically and religiously and was firmly convinced that the events of Revelation were either being played out or about to be played out. His views in this book are very similar to that of dispensationalists.
This, the second edition of the book, contains an appendix dealing with the first World War which was then in full swing, and how the author believed it was fulfilling prophecy.
